Find out more about what a great place Companies House is to work As a Data Developer, you will help support and develop the existing and future data requirements of Companies House. You will grow your skill and experience in the tools and technologies currently used to deliver public and internal services at Companies House, which include Oracle, MongoDB and PL/SQL development. You will also provide database administration and support for the databases that form part of the development, end to end and test services. You will have the opportunity to be involved in the migration of these databases to public Cloud and to help shape and deliver transformation of Companies House services. If this sounds like something you can see yourself being involved with, we’d love to receive your application. Responsibilities: This is a graduate level position within the Data Engineering specialism that sits within our wider infrastructure team; the successful candidate will possess a grounding in the necessary PL/SQL, data development and database administration skills to support and deliver the data components required to support Companies House services. The role includes: Working with analysts, customers, development and support teams, ensuring outcome and quality requirements are delivered. Working in an Agile environment on multiple projects, alongside other professions, to deliver our core business systems. Configure and install solutions to meet the business and user need, ensuring agreed standards and the Companies House Change Management process is adhered to. Respond to and resolve incidents to meet agreed targets. Provide root cause analysis to problems and propose/implement appropriate corrective actions.
